Maximizing Cloud Value: Agility, Resilience & Cost Optimization with Multi-Cloud
Modern businesses are moving beyond single-cloud setups to unlock greater flexibility, reduce risks, and control spending. A well-planned multi-cloud strategy helps organizations spread workloads across different cloud providers while gaining the unique strengths each platform offers.
Who this guide is for: IT leaders, cloud architects, and business executives who want to build a robust multi-cloud approach that drives real business results.
We’ll walk through how multi-cloud implementation boosts your organization’s ability to adapt quickly to market changes and customer demands. You’ll discover proven methods for building rock-solid cloud resilience that keeps your systems running even when one provider faces issues. We’ll also share practical cloud cost optimization techniques that help you get maximum value from your cloud investments without breaking the budget.
Ready to transform your cloud infrastructure into a competitive advantage? Let’s explore how the right multi-cloud architecture can supercharge your business growth.
Understanding Multi-Cloud Strategy for Business Growth
Defining multi-cloud architecture and its key components
Multi-cloud architecture distributes workloads across multiple cloud providers like AWS, Azure, and Google Cloud. Core components include cloud management platforms, API gateways, identity management systems, and network connectivity tools. This setup gives organizations flexibility to choose best-of-breed services while avoiding vendor lock-in. Key elements also encompass monitoring dashboards, security frameworks, and data integration layers that ensure seamless operations across different cloud environments.
Differentiating multi-cloud from hybrid and single-cloud approaches
Single-cloud strategies rely on one provider, creating dependency but simplifying management. Hybrid cloud combines on-premises infrastructure with cloud services, perfect for organizations with strict compliance requirements. Multi-cloud strategy spreads resources across multiple public cloud providers without on-premises integration. The main difference lies in risk distribution and service optimization—while hybrid focuses on location flexibility, multi-cloud emphasizes provider diversity and service specialization.
Approach | Providers | On-Premises | Primary Benefit | Main Challenge |
---|---|---|---|---|
Single-Cloud | One | No | Simplicity | Vendor Lock-in |
Hybrid Cloud | One+ | Yes | Compliance Control | Complexity |
Multi-Cloud | Multiple | Optional | Provider Choice | Management Overhead |
Identifying when multi-cloud becomes essential for enterprise success
Multi-cloud implementation becomes crucial when organizations need specialized services unavailable from single providers. Companies handling sensitive data across different regions benefit from geographic distribution capabilities. High-availability requirements pushing 99.99% uptime make multi-cloud architecture essential. Organizations experiencing rapid growth need the scalability options that multiple providers offer. Regulatory compliance spanning different jurisdictions often demands multi-cloud strategies for data sovereignty and regional service requirements.
Achieving Enhanced Agility Through Multi-Cloud Implementation
Accelerating Application Deployment Across Diverse Platforms
Multi-cloud implementation transforms how businesses deploy applications by spreading workloads across multiple cloud providers. Teams can choose the optimal platform for each application based on specific requirements, performance needs, and geographic proximity to users. This approach eliminates the constraints of single-provider limitations, allowing developers to deploy containerized applications on AWS for compute-intensive tasks while running databases on Google Cloud Platform for superior analytics capabilities. The result is faster time-to-market and improved application performance across different environments.
Enabling Rapid Scaling Based on Demand Fluctuations
Cloud agility reaches its peak when organizations can instantly scale resources across multiple providers based on real-time demand patterns. During traffic spikes, applications automatically distribute load between Azure and AWS infrastructure, ensuring consistent performance without manual intervention. This dynamic scaling capability means businesses pay only for resources they use while maintaining seamless user experiences. Smart workload distribution algorithms monitor performance metrics and automatically shift computing power to the most cost-effective and available cloud resources.
Facilitating Faster Innovation Cycles with Best-of-Breed Services
Multi-cloud architecture unlocks access to specialized services from different providers, accelerating innovation cycles significantly. Developers can integrate AWS machine learning services with Google Cloud’s data analytics tools and Microsoft Azure’s IoT capabilities within a single application ecosystem. This best-of-breed approach eliminates the need to wait for a single vendor to develop comparable features, enabling teams to build cutting-edge solutions using the strongest capabilities from each cloud provider. Innovation speed increases dramatically when teams can cherry-pick the most advanced services available.
Reducing Vendor Lock-in for Strategic Flexibility
Breaking free from vendor lock-in creates unprecedented strategic flexibility for business growth and technology evolution. Multi-cloud implementation ensures that applications and data remain portable across different cloud environments, preventing dependence on any single provider’s roadmap or pricing changes. Organizations can negotiate better contracts, switch providers for specific workloads, and adapt quickly to changing business requirements. This flexibility becomes crucial during mergers, acquisitions, or when exploring emerging technologies that may be better supported by different cloud vendors.
Building Unbreakable Resilience with Distributed Cloud Infrastructure
Creating redundancy across multiple cloud providers
Building true cloud resilience means spreading your workloads across different cloud providers like AWS, Azure, and Google Cloud. This distributed cloud infrastructure approach protects your business from provider-specific outages or service disruptions. When one cloud experiences downtime, your applications continue running on alternative platforms. Smart organizations design their multi-cloud architecture with geographic distribution, ensuring data replication across multiple regions and providers. This redundancy strategy transforms potential single points of failure into resilient, interconnected systems that maintain operational continuity regardless of individual cloud provider issues.
Implementing automatic failover mechanisms for business continuity
Modern multi-cloud management systems can detect failures and automatically redirect traffic to healthy cloud instances within seconds. These failover mechanisms monitor application health, network connectivity, and service availability across all cloud providers simultaneously. When issues arise, load balancers instantly route users to functioning endpoints while triggering recovery procedures. Database synchronization ensures data consistency during transitions, while automated scaling compensates for sudden traffic increases. This seamless switching happens transparently to end users, maintaining service quality and preventing revenue loss during unexpected outages.
Minimizing single points of failure in critical systems
Strategic multi-cloud implementation eliminates dependency on any single cloud service or region. Critical applications run simultaneously across multiple providers, with real-time data synchronization ensuring consistency. Network architecture includes diverse connectivity paths, preventing communication breakdowns. Database clusters span different cloud environments, while backup systems maintain copies across separate platforms. This approach extends beyond infrastructure to include diverse vendor relationships, skill sets, and operational procedures. Every system component has alternatives ready to activate, creating an unbreakable chain of redundancy that keeps businesses operational under any circumstances.
Mastering Cost Optimization Strategies in Multi-Cloud Environments
Leveraging competitive pricing across cloud vendors
Smart organizations play cloud providers against each other to drive down costs. AWS, Azure, and Google Cloud frequently undercut each other on specific services, creating opportunities for strategic workload distribution. By maintaining relationships with multiple vendors, businesses can negotiate better rates and take advantage of promotional pricing. Some companies save 20-30% simply by switching compute-intensive workloads to whichever provider offers the best current rates for their specific requirements.
Implementing intelligent workload placement for cost efficiency
Workload placement becomes an art form in multi-cloud strategy environments. Machine learning algorithms now analyze historical usage patterns, performance requirements, and real-time pricing to automatically recommend optimal cloud placement. For example, data processing jobs might run cheaper on Google Cloud during off-peak hours, while web applications perform better on AWS’s edge network. This intelligent orchestration ensures every workload runs where it delivers maximum value at minimum cost.
Utilizing reserved instances and spot pricing strategically
Reserved instances and spot pricing create massive savings opportunities when used strategically across multiple clouds. Reserved instances work best for predictable workloads, offering up to 75% savings for long-term commitments. Spot instances handle batch processing and development environments at 50-90% discounts. The key lies in spreading these commitments across different providers to avoid vendor lock-in while maximizing cloud cost optimization. Smart companies maintain a portfolio approach, balancing stability with opportunistic savings.
Monitoring and controlling cross-cloud data transfer costs
Data transfer fees between clouds can quickly spiral out of control without proper monitoring. These “data egress” charges often catch organizations off-guard, sometimes reaching thousands monthly. Successful multi-cloud management requires implementing data governance policies that minimize unnecessary transfers. Companies use content delivery networks, regional data replication, and intelligent caching to reduce cross-cloud traffic. Real-time monitoring dashboards track transfer volumes and costs, triggering alerts when thresholds are exceeded.
Right-sizing resources based on actual usage patterns
Most cloud resources run significantly oversized, wasting 30-60% of allocated capacity. Multi-cloud implementation amplifies this challenge across different platforms with varying sizing options. Modern right-sizing tools analyze actual CPU, memory, and storage utilization patterns across all cloud environments, recommending optimal configurations. Some platforms automatically scale resources up or down based on demand, ensuring you only pay for what you actually use while maintaining performance standards.
Overcoming Multi-Cloud Management Challenges
Establishing Unified Governance and Security Policies
Creating consistent governance across multiple cloud providers requires standardized security frameworks that work seamlessly between AWS, Azure, and Google Cloud. Organizations need centralized identity management systems that enforce role-based access controls, data encryption standards, and compliance requirements uniformly across all platforms. The key lies in developing cloud-agnostic policies that can adapt to each provider’s specific security tools while maintaining your organization’s core security posture. This approach prevents security gaps that often emerge when teams manage each cloud environment in isolation.
Streamlining Operations with Centralized Monitoring Tools
Multi-cloud management becomes significantly easier when you deploy unified monitoring platforms that aggregate data from all your cloud environments into a single dashboard. Tools like Datadog, New Relic, or custom solutions built on Prometheus can track performance metrics, cost analytics, and security events across different providers simultaneously. This centralized visibility eliminates the need to jump between multiple vendor-specific consoles, reducing operational overhead and improving response times to critical issues. Teams can set up cross-cloud alerts and automated responses that trigger regardless of which platform experiences problems.
Managing Complexity Through Automation and Orchestration
Automation transforms multi-cloud complexity from a burden into a competitive advantage by standardizing deployment processes across different providers. Infrastructure as Code tools like Terraform or Pulumi enable teams to define cloud resources once and deploy them consistently whether you’re using AWS CloudFormation, Azure Resource Manager, or Google Cloud Deployment Manager. Container orchestration platforms like Kubernetes provide another layer of abstraction that makes applications truly portable between clouds. This automation reduces human error, accelerates deployment cycles, and ensures that your multi-cloud architecture operates predictably at scale.
Ensuring Consistent Performance Across Different Platforms
Performance consistency in multi-cloud environments demands careful attention to network latency, data transfer patterns, and service-level agreements between providers. Organizations must establish performance baselines for each cloud platform and implement monitoring systems that track application response times, database query performance, and API call latencies across all environments. Load balancing strategies become critical for distributing traffic intelligently between clouds based on real-time performance metrics rather than static configurations. Regular performance testing and capacity planning help identify bottlenecks before they impact user experience, ensuring your distributed cloud infrastructure delivers reliable service regardless of which provider handles specific workloads.
Multi-cloud strategies have become game-changers for businesses ready to break free from single-vendor limitations and unlock serious competitive advantages. When you spread your digital operations across multiple cloud providers, you’re not just diversifying risk—you’re setting up your company to move faster, bounce back stronger from disruptions, and squeeze every dollar of value from your cloud investments. The flexibility to choose the best tools for each job while avoiding vendor lock-in gives you the kind of strategic freedom that can make or break modern business operations.
Managing multiple clouds does come with its fair share of complexity, but the payoff makes it worth tackling those challenges head-on. Smart businesses are already seeing the benefits: faster innovation cycles, rock-solid disaster recovery, and cloud bills that actually make sense. If you’re still running everything on a single cloud platform, now’s the time to start exploring how a multi-cloud approach could transform your operations. The companies that master this strategy today will be the ones setting the pace tomorrow.